[ ] Key ceremony item 4: verify the Lexiharvest string-extraction script ran cleanly before sealing. The script walks the Fernwick app repos, pulls translatable strings into the catalog, and signs the bundle with the ceremony key. Confirm zero extraction warnings and a matching catalog hash in the log. If the signing step prompts to unlock the offline keystore, enter the recovery passphrase noted immediately below.

unlock words, yawig-kagef: gordor-holvan-ulaael-pramir-ulaiel-tamdor

## Provenance: Profilecore Shard Migration

For this week's sync: the Dovetail team split the user-profile store into twelve shards keyed by account region. Each shard migration job is built from a pinned manifest, and the artifact hash is recorded at cutover so rollbacks map to exact binaries. No shard moves without a verified build record. The current migration build is identified by the token below.

session token of tajef-bageg = htk21_5d90d574934f3ccae6437

Onboarding note for the eng sync: all third-party fonts used in Glimmerset UI must be vendored into the assets repo, not fetched at build time. This keeps builds reproducible and avoids upstream outages. Each vendored font bundle must be verified before merge, using the key below.

signing key of kahog-kadup = bky13_6wLyxnPsJob4P

## Further reading

If you're reviewing Pixelvault's image cache, you'll want the backstory on the leak we fixed in the Thornbury release. Short version: evicted entries kept a strong reference via the decode callback, so the cache never actually shrank under pressure. The fix adds weak refs plus a watchdog that dumps heap stats when residency exceeds the cap. The full postmortem, repro steps, and the watchdog design notes are collected here:

operations page: https://jenkins.zemvarcloud.local/job/merge_requests/repo/build/73930b4b30f0a8ed

## Data Stores: Report Exports

All report timestamps in Larkspool are stored as UTC in the `exports` schema. Conversion to the customer's timezone happens at export time only, using the `tz_pref` column on the account record. Never store local times. DST edge cases are handled by the `tzshift` helper — use it, don't hand-roll offsets. Export jobs read from the reporting replica, reachable via this connection string.

replica DSN, yahaf-yagaf: mongodb://tamath_svc:a2netSk3RZMuTj@db-d084.novacsoft.internal:5432/ralmir